Inventory Planner/Analyst

Reports To:        Inventory Supervisor

Function:            Supply Chain – Logistics, Inventory

Location:            Trinidad & Tobago

Purpose:  

  • The position is a key member of the Logistics Inventory team as a focal point delivering inventory services and guidance to the business.
  • Contributes to the monitoring, analysis evaluation and management of inventory to support our operations and functions
  • Ensure parts availability for the Operations by managing exceptions and expediting requests through the Tracker
  • To ensure availability of inventory to support efficient, cost-effective supply to meet the forecast requirements of internal business partners to enable planned and emergent activities within agreed KPIs.

  • Management of exceptions, assessing parts availability for scheduled work and make recommendations in line with the inventory planning process
  • Review of free text items, identify opportunities for transfers and ensure parts availability alignment with work orders
  • Coordinates proactively and effectively to expedite delivery of materials when schedule changes cannot be accommodated
  • Manages demand thru the release of purchase requisitions, seeks to utilize inventory from within the network by transferring stock when possible
  • Applies relevant material classification and stocking strategies in order to optimize inventory levels.
  • Coordination with Procurement for the sourcing of materials and identification of materials to be added to existing outline agreements
  • Applies an understanding of end-to-end Supply Chain to enhance efficiency, drive optimization, and maximize value; strive to achieve 100% safety, 100% customer value and 0% waste
  • Campaign Requirement and Transfer Analysis including financial impacts
  • Coordination and Correspondence with Joint venture Partners, Principal Negotiators, and Finance
  • Maintain stocking strategies and inventory rulesets
  • Maintain min/max levels and safety stock
  • Identify and address potential issues such as stock-outs and minimise waste
  • Monitor and address MRP exceptions
  • Address inventory enquiries from stakeholders
  • Manage refurbishment of routable inventory items
  • Process master data updates for new and existing materials and support phase out of obsolete materials
  • Ensure capital spares are purchased and serialised through correct processes
  • Ensure inventory compliance with Joint Venture requirements 
  • Generate inventory reports and KPIs on monthly or ad-hoc basis as needed
  • Identify and recommend master data cleansing, alignment and improvement
  • Support slow moving inventory and obsolete inventory reduction and improvement programmes for inventory.
  • Comply with and recommend improvements to processes and procedures.
  • Comply with Risk Management protocols.
